Select the correct answer from each drop-down menu. if f(x)=x^2+2x-3 and g(x)=x^2-9, find (f/g)(4) and (f+g)(4).

Respuesta :

Space
Space Space
  • 02-07-2020

Answer:

(f/g)(4) = 3

(f + g)(4) = 28

Step-by-step explanation:

(f/g) = [tex]\frac{x^2+2x-3}{x^2-9}[/tex]

(f + g) = [tex]2x^2 + 2x -12[/tex]

Simply plug in 4 for x in both equations to find you answer!
